Post D-Mat's value

It's a crazy thing that hype. It makes you do crazy things.

Like say, potentially pay $51.1 million dollars just to hold a 30-day dialogue with the agent who drives the hardest bargain in the business, Scott Boras. Or pick a 26-year-old rookie from Japan too early in a Fantasy Baseball draft next spring, Daisuke Matsuzaka, who might be trying on his new Red Sox next spring.

It's not that we don't like Matsuzaka. Anyone who throws in the high-90s, has good offspeed pitches and has a trademark breaking pitch with a flashy name (the "gyroball"*) has to be marked "intriguing" or better in our book.
